Q: Why does the Fairgate pricing experiment branch on a hashed user bucket instead of a plain flag?

A: Good catch — it's intentional. The ticket-pricing test needs stable assignment across sessions, and plain flags reshuffled users on every deploy, which wrecked the stats. Don't "simplify" it back, please. The bucketing rationale and analysis plan are written up on the page below.

wiki page, bagaf-fawip: https://harbor.tolvaqsys.local/pages/repo/pages/secrets/eac969ffc71f356b

☐ Key ceremony step 7 — Verify that the Quillhaven relevance tuning notes for the Searchlark ranking model are sealed in the same envelope as the signing shard. The notes must reflect the boost weights approved at the Marlowbridge review, with no handwritten amendments. Once both witnesses initial the envelope flap and the custodian confirms the tamper seal number, record the recovery passphrase exactly as spoken below.

recovery phrase for fajeg-hagug: holox-fenmir

**Ticket: CrashFunnel intake flaking again**

Hey all — since Tuesday the CrashFunnel pipeline has been dropping connections while ingesting crash reports from the Pebblewing mobile app. Roughly 12% of batches fail with a timeout before the symbolication step even starts. Retries mask most of it, but the backlog hit 40k reports overnight. Marla bumped the pool size; no luck. To reproduce locally, point the ingest worker at the staging reports database using the connection string below.

replica DSN, kajep-yahag: mssql://praok_svc:iF@db-8d68.plorvaio.local:5432/eliion

**Authentication**

The Quillsage relevance tuning notes live behind the internal Notewarden API. Support staff reviewing ranking changes must authenticate every request; unauthenticated reads were disabled after the Larkmoor audit. Requests are read-only and scoped to the tuning workspace. Include the following internal key in the request header exactly as issued.

gateway credential: kto3_qfe